Yvonne Kone

Yvonne Kone combines the minimalism of Danish design with a colorful style that is derived from her Ivory Coast lineage to create luxurious Italian-made leather products and cashmere accessories. Her take-anywhere pieces are distinguished by an architectural and minimalist style in terms of form and material as well as texture. They are a celebration of story and heritage, and are a tribute to traditional craftsmanship.

The bags made by the brand are black and feature a mix of classic designs and bold hues, from sleek saddle designs to versatile bucket bags. The eponymous label is a go-to for fuss-free modern women with an eye for timeless style.

Sarep + Rose

Established by Robin Sirleaf, the lifestyle brand Sarep + Rose blends style with social responsibility. The founder travels around Africa to source materials and team up with designers to create a modern take on the casual everyday accessory. Her extensive line of artisan-made leather bags, footwear and decorative storage baskets for the home alter narratives about the continent.

Her collections use Fish Skin leather (a texture made by dried pike fish skin) and Sisal baskets to evoke an evocative modern African style. Add a fun bow or flower decoration to a top-handle design to switch up the look.

Petit Kouraj

Nasrin Jean Baptiste, a fashion stylist who founded Petit Kouraj, which is the Haitian Creole term for "little courage". After many years of styling, she listened to her inner voice and designed a luxury bag line that combines knitwear, sculpture and cultural identity.

Jean-Baptiste collaborated with a group of women from Haiti to design her crochet bags. She used 100% cotton net, rayon fringe and leather handles. They can spend up 12 hours on a bag.

Valerie Blaise

Created by self-taught designer/artisan Valerie Blaise in Brooklyn New York. VAVVOUNE is a luxury leather accessory brand that is renowned for its cultured design. The brand's design and production process is inspired by moods, nostalgia, and practicality.

BruceGlen

When you think of black bags, the fashion world has been blessed by Virgil Abloh's Off-White and a myriad of other designer labels that have changed our culture. BruceGlen is a new brand that has entered the conversation.

The identical twins who designed the line created a line that is appreciated by fashionistas for its use of striking colors and attractive hardware. What makes BruceGlen truly stand out is their dedication to sustainability.

The brand has just debuted their first collection ever on the runway at NYFW which was dedicated to their late mother's legacy. The collection for Fall 2022 featured various looks that featured glitter, rainbows and glass window designs. The brothers also partnered with Resonance which provides a transparency tool that reveals details about carbon emissions as well as the use of water in fabrics.

Anima Iris

If you are looking for a stylish modern, contemporary bag that speaks to your fashion-conscious spirit, Anima Iris is the brand for you. Wilglory Tanjong is the founder of this luxury purse brand. She is a full-time MBA Student who founded it in 2020.

The bags of the brand are made by hand in Dakar, Senegal. Each bag bears the name of the family member or close friend, like Anima and Iris, one of Wilglory's best friends from childhood.

While many luxury brands focus on promoting European heritage, Anima Iris' designs focus on African culture and the past.
